About Eva Anne Mørtsell
Eva Anne Mørtsell is a scholar working on Aerospace Engineering, Structural Biology and Mechanical Engineering, having authored 21 papers that have together received 542 indexed citations. Recurring topics across this work include Aluminum Alloy Microstructure Properties (20 papers), Aluminum Alloys Composites Properties (18 papers) and Microstructure and mechanical properties (15 papers). The work is most often cited by research in Aerospace Engineering (512 citations), Mechanical Engineering (476 citations) and Materials Chemistry (385 citations). Eva Anne Mørtsell has collaborated with scholars based in Norway, Japan and China. Frequent co-authors include Randi Holmestad, Calin D. Marioara, Yanjun Li, Sigmund J. Andersen, Astrid Marie F. Muggerud, Jesper Friis, Takeshi Saito, Sigurd Wenner, Feng Qian and Oddvin Reiso. Their work appears in journals such as Acta Materialia, Materials Science and Engineering A and Journal of Alloys and Compounds.
